Fake drugs in Ghana
The World Health Organization reports that counterfeit drugs makes up to 30 percent of the total medicine market in Ghana. A large portion of the fakes are imported from Nigeria.
Price of Children in Ghana
The human trafficking market in Ghana allows a child to be purchased from parent for $50. Then, the trafficker can either sell or lease out that child for up to $300, thus making $250 in profit a year.
